Gramatik Announces Red Rocks Show

Article Contributed by Camille Cushman | Published on Tuesday, January 10, 2017

2016 was an exceptional year for NYC by-way-of Slovenia producer / DJ Gramatik. After teasing his upcoming album throughout 2015 at some of the biggest venues and festivals in the world, the Epigram LP finally dropped in March 2016 to wide acclaim from peers and critics alike. This served as a starting point for Gramatik’s enormous worldwide tour in support of the release, with highlights including an album release party at Zenith in Paris, Europe's largest music festival Roskilde, and a New Year’s extravaganza with Bassnectar in Alabama.

Still, Colorado’s Red Rocks Amphitheater remains one of Gramatik’s favorite places on Earth. Following 2015’s epic Blizzmatik show and last year’s reprise, he is making his annual return to the legendary amphitheater this spring with an all new support line-up and completely re-worked stage design. A trio of incredible artists have been invited to share the stage and add their own flavor to the unforgettable event. Making his Red Rocks debut, Mr. Carmack is a producer / DJ who is increasingly becoming one of the strongest voices of the undefined musical area between hip hop and electronic music. Also stepping up to the plate will be a young Canadian artist from Vancouver, Ekali, who already has a writing credit on the latest Drake record. Finally, Flamingosis, a music producer, beatboxer and DJ hailing from New Jersey will be hoping on the decks for a turn to show off his critically renowned sound.

Along with the new line-up of talent, Gramatik will be using the 2017 Red Rocks show to bring back the now re-worked Nikola Tesla-inspired stage design fans may remember from a few years back.
